Can be tho, tank is quite new, 3 months.
Coraline won't start showing up until after the uglies are over with. At 3 months you're just getting started. Everything is going to turn green, then gha everywhere, then coraline is the usual progression.

Can be tho, tank is quite new, 3 months.
Coralline will not just show up on it's own, it must be introduced into the tank by something. That is why I asked if anything in thank had it. Like snails shell? real live rock? Bottled coralline? Something, otherwise no. Yes it can indeed start to appear at 3 months, not likely, but possible, yes. It just has to have come in to the tank somehow.
